King Appoints Prince Salman bin Sultan as Emir of Madinah and Prince Faisal bin Salman as His Special Advisor

King Salman has appointed Prince Salman bin Sultan as the emir of Madinah with ministerial rank and named Prince Faisal bin Salman as his special advisor.
Tuesday's royal decrees further designated Prince Faisal as chairman of both the King Abdulaziz Foundation for Research and Archives and the King Fahd National Library Board of Trustees on recommendation from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man.

Additionally, new deputy emirs were appointed: Prince Saud bin Mishaal for Makkah, succeeding Prince Badr bin Sultan; Prince Saud bin Bandar for the Eastern Province, replacing Prince Ahmed bin Fahd bin Salman; and deputy emirs for Tabuk, Al-Jouf, and Asir as Prince Khalid bin Saud bin Abdullah, Prince Miteb bin Mishaal, and Prince Khaled bin Sattam, respectively. Prince Mansour bin Muhammad was succeeded by Prince Abdulrahman bin Abdullah as governor of Hafar Al-Batin.

Other key appointments include Dr. Hisham bin Abdulrahman as assistant interior minister, Dr. Khalid bin Mohammed as deputy interior minister, Khaled bin Farid as Royal Court advisor, Eng. Khalil bin Ibrahim as deputy minister of industry for industrial affairs, Dr. Abdullah Al-Maghlouth as assistant media minister, Musaed bin Abdulaziz as Makkah mayor, Eng. Abdullah bin Mahdi as Asir mayor, Dr. Yousef bin Sayyah as General Intelligence deputy chief, and Zuhair Al-Zuman as Human Rights Commission assistant president.

The King has instructed the relevant bodies to carry out these orders.
